Garrillo Last Name Facts
Where Does The Last Name Garrillo Come From? nationality or country of origin
The last name Garrillo is found in Venezuela more than any other country or territory. It may be found in the variant forms:. For other potential spellings of Garrillo click here.
How Common Is The Last Name Garrillo? popularity and diffusion
The last name is the 374,643rd most frequently held family name worldwide It is held by approximately 1 in 7,622,956 people. The surname Garrillo is primarily found in The Americas, where 100 percent of Garrillo live; 97 percent live in South America and 95 percent live in Caribbean South America.
The last name is most prevalent in Venezuela, where it is carried by 902 people, or 1 in 33,486. In Venezuela Garrillo is mostly found in: Zulia, where 71 percent are found, Mérida, where 5 percent are found and Lara, where 4 percent are found. Outside of Venezuela it occurs in 9 countries. It is also common in The United States, where 2 percent are found and Colombia, where 1 percent are found.
Garrillo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The frequency of Garrillo has changed over time. In The United States the share of the population with the surname expanded 2,000 percent between 1880 and 2014.
